Tic-Tac-Toe...

Two friends hanging out playing a simple game of
Tic-Tac-Toe discussing poetry, why we enjoy it and
what we plan to do with it,

Then approaches Satan and says " move over I'm playing "
Then it says " you 2 can't win, I'm the X's & the O's "
Jamestown replies " ha ha, what kind of evil gives out hugs & kisses "
Sin in Sincerity says " you are the coward we always knew you were"
Immediately drops 2 X's on his eyes and says " Good-Bye "

We read a scripture over it's fallen soul
and are wondering why he forgot God was on our side
before it tried bringing the pain, it must be insane to
step to 2 men that are ordained, we didn't need any circles
as we stand over his body that's now turning purple,

So needless to say the Devil losses again, buy now
one would think it understands God doesn't pretend,

Real recognizes real and will never play with the fake, that's
why Sin in Sincerity & Jamestown stay in Gods good grace
constantly laughing in this cowards face,

Lucifer and his demons approach everyday, but with God
leading the way these morons are not welcome to stay,

Tic-Tac-Toe loser time to go!!!
